Universal Merchant Bank CEO picks top award

Chief Executive Officer (CEO) of Universal Merchant Bank, John Awuah, has been adjudged the Finance Personality of the Year at the just-ended 4th Ghana Finance Innovation Awards (GFIA).

Mr. Awuah received the Finance Personality of the Year Award based on his enviable track record and shrewd leadership at UMB.

The event took place at Mövenpick Ambassador Hotel in Accra on 19th of October, 2018.

The award criteria were based on his huge contribution and many years of experience in areas such as financial control, regulatory reporting, credit control, performance management, taxation, market risk monitoring, financial accounting, operational risk and corporate strategy.

The bank was also presented with the Best Customer Experience Award.

In the past year, the CEO of UMB has championed a myriad of forward-thinking physical and digital innovations that have significantly improved the way the bank operates and enhanced its profitability.

Notable among these achievements is the impressive financial performance of the bank in 2017; profit-before-tax was in excess of 150 per cent over the performance recorded in the previous year, 2016.

Also, in the digital mobile banking space, Mr. Awuah spearheaded the successful introduction of the bank’s mobile banking application in 2018, UMB SpeedApp, which has since become one of the top finance applications in the industry following its official media launch in February 2018.

The convenient services and features on the UMB SpeedApp are available to both customers and non-customers, and as such a lot of the users have resorted to making transactions on the mobile platform as against visiting the bank’s various branches nationwide to do business.

The introduction of the mobile application was in line with the bank’s plan to digitize the banking experience of its existing customers, as well as potential customers.

In his interaction with the media at the event, the CEO of UMB, expressed his appreciation for the honour bestowed on him and dedicated the award to the loyal customers of the bank and staff at UMB for their commitment to work.

The 4th Ghana Finance Innovation Awards (GFIA) was used to recognize leading, finance experts, teams and top finance organizations, whose outstanding leadership and practices elevated the standards of accountability within the profession, showcased brilliancy in managing organizations’ wealth, as well as promoting economic growth.
